汉字拆解
老 (venerable) + 师 (master, expert) — a venerable master, a teacher
含义
Teacher. The standard respectful title for a teacher or instructor.
Used as both a title and a form of address. In Chinese culture, 老师 carries deep respect. Can also be used as a polite title for any knowledgeable person, not just school teachers. Address form: 王老师 (Teacher Wang).

正确说法
- 老师好!(Hello, teacher!)
- 谢谢老师!(Thank you, teacher!)
错误说法
- 老师,你错了。(Directly saying 'you're wrong' to a teacher sounds blunt — soften with 老师,是不是这样...)
起源与历史
Compound of 老 (venerable, experienced) and 师 (master, expert). Reflects the deep cultural respect for teachers in Chinese society — someone venerable and masterful.
